In a dramatic turn of events, French authorities have apprehended five additional suspects linked to the infamous Louvre jewel heist. This development comes after the initial arrest of two individuals in connection with the daring robbery, which took place at the iconic museum in Paris. Despite the arrests, the stolen treasures, including precious jewels, remain missing, adding a layer of mystery to the ongoing investigation.
According to reports from various sources, including Breaking News, The New York Times, and France 24, the authorities have now detained a total of seven suspects in relation to the heist. However, the recovered stolen items have not been disclosed, leaving the fate of the missing jewels uncertain. One of the apprehended individuals is believed to be part of the four-person team responsible for the robbery, leaving one member still at large.
